While filing I-485, what kind of medical tests reports we need to submit. Please advise us or give some site where I can find this information. Thanks.
 
There is a specific USCIS form, I-693, that you need to take to a USCIS designated doctor in your area (called a "civil surgeon") to fill out. The doctor will give you a medical test and perform some vaccinations or evaluate your previous vaccination record, and will fill the form accordingly. The doctor will then seal the form and give it back to you, and you must include this sealed envelope with your application. Follow the instructions here.

Also, this page will help you find a "civil surgeon" in your area. Some smaller states have very few of them. You may need to call and make an appointment. You will usually need to make 2 trips to the office.
 
Bring your vaccination records when you go to see the doctor for the green card medical. The doctor will look at the records and reduce the number of new vaccinations based on the old ones shown in your records.
